btf: Optimize type lookup with binary search

Improve btf_find_by_name_kind() performance by adding binary search
support for sorted types. Falls back to linear search for compatibility.

+/*
+ * btf_named_start_id - Get the named starting ID for the BTF
+ * @btf: Pointer to the target BTF object
+ * @own: Flag indicating whether to query only the current BTF (true = current BTF only,
+ *       false = recursively traverse the base BTF chain)
+ *
+ * Return value rules:
+ * 1. For a sorted btf, return its named_start_id
+ * 2. Else for a split BTF, return its start_id
+ * 3. Else for a base BTF, return 1
+ */
+u32 btf_named_start_id(const struct btf *btf, bool own)
+{
+       const struct btf *base_btf = btf;
+
+       while (!own && base_btf->base_btf)
+               base_btf = base_btf->base_btf;
+
+       return base_btf->named_start_id ?: (base_btf->start_id ?: 1);
+}
+
+static s32 btf_find_by_name_kind_bsearch(const struct btf *btf, const char *name)
+{
+       const struct btf_type *t;
+       const char *tname;
+       s32 l, r, m;
+
+       l = btf_named_start_id(btf, true);
+       r = btf_nr_types(btf) - 1;
+       while (l <= r) {
+               m = l + (r - l) / 2;
+               t = btf_type_by_id(btf, m);
+               tname = btf_name_by_offset(btf, t->name_off);
+               if (strcmp(tname, name) >= 0) {
+                       if (l == r)
+                               return r;
+                       r = m;
+               } else {
+                       l = m + 1;
+               }
+       }
+
+       return btf_nr_types(btf);
+}
